Definition of death duty no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

death duty

noun
 
/ˈdeθ djuːti/
 
/ˈdeθ duːti/
[usually plural] (British English, old-fashioned)
jump to other results
  1. inheritance tax (= tax that you must pay on the money or property that you receive from somebody when they die)
